You can send a copy of a note in a different format, but that’s it. The Android app does not have any collaboration features. The OneNote desktop, iOS, and iPad offer to share notebooks with view and edit permissions. Google Keep lets you add people to collaborate, send a copy of the note via other apps, and convert and edit notes in Google Docs. Google Keep is consistent regarding sharing and collaboration, whereas OneNote is not.
